A Creative Summer in Italy

The Creative School Cortona is a unique transdisciplinary learning experience in the heart of Tuscany, Italy.

Enrol in The Creative School’s transdisciplinary courses for a distinct opportunity to apply your creativity in a new environment and engage with international challenges. Learn about the cultural heritage of Tuscany through art, design and media in collaboration with local Italian industry partners and community members. The Cortona Experience is offered to you in partnership with Cortona On The Move. (external link)
